目录
前言
在当今互联网环境下,很多网站和服务都受到了不同程度的封锁和限制,这给用户的上网体验带来了很大的不便。为了解决这一问题,shadowsocks作为一种流行的科学上网工具应运而生。其中,chacha算法凭借其出色的性能和安全性,也逐渐成为了shadowsocks的首选加密方式。
本文将为大家详细介绍如何通过一键安装的方式快速部署shadowsocks chacha,并解答使用过程中的常见问题,希望能为广大用户提供一份全面而实用的使用指南。
安装前的准备
在开始安装shadowsocks chacha之前,需要做好以下几点准备工作:
- 准备一台可以稳定访问国外服务器的VPS或云服务器。
- 确保服务器的系统为Windows、MacOS或Linux之一。
- 安装Git和Python3环境(Linux系统可以跳过这一步)。
- 关闭服务器上的防火墙或开放相关端口。
一键安装教程
Windows系统
-
打开PowerShell或CMD命令提示符。
-
运行以下命令进行安装: powershell git clone https://github.com/the0demiurge/CharlesScripts cd CharlesScripts/charles python install.py
-
根据提示输入相关配置信息,如服务器地址、端口、密码等。
-
安装完成后,shadowsocks chacha客户端会自动启动,可以开始使用了。
MacOS系统
-
打开Terminal终端。
-
运行以下命令进行安装: bash git clone https://github.com/the0demiurge/CharlesScripts cd CharlesScripts/charles python3 install.py
-
根据提示输入相关配置信息,如服务器地址、端口、密码等。
-
安装完成后,shadowsocks chacha客户端会自动启动,可以开始使用了。
Linux系统
-
打开Terminal终端。
-
运行以下命令进行安装: bash git clone https://github.com/the0demiurge/CharlesScripts cd CharlesScripts/charles python3 install.py
-
根据提示输入相关配置信息,如服务器地址、端口、密码等。
-
安装完成后,shadowsocks chacha客户端会自动启动,可以开始使用了。
常见问题解答
什么是shadowsocks?
Shadowsocks是一种基于SOCKS5代理方式的加密传输协议,它能够有效地突破网络审查和封锁,为用户提供安全、稳定的科学上网体验。
为什么要使用shadowsocks?
使用shadowsocks可以突破网络封锁,访问被禁止的网站和服务。同时,它还能加密用户的网络流量,提高上网安全性,保护用户的隐私。
chacha算法有什么优势?
chacha算法是一种高效的流式加密算法,它在保证安全性的同时,还具有较快的加解密速度。相比于传统的AES算法,chacha算法能够更好地利用CPU资源,提高shadowsocks的整体性能。
一键安装有什么好处?
shadowsocks chacha的一键安装脚本能够自动完成服务器端和客户端的部署,大大简化了安装过程。用户只需要按照提示输入几个基本信息,就可以轻松地部署好整个shadowsocks系统,大大提高了使用体验。
如何确保安全性?
为了确保shadowsocks chacha的使用安全性,建议用户采取以下措施:
- 使用强密码,避免使用简单易猜的密码
- 定期更换密码,提高安全性
- 配合其他安全工具,如VPN、Tor等,提高上网安全性
- 关注shadowsocks社区的最新动态,了解安全风险并及时更新